CM_Free_Log_Conf_Ex Funktion (cfgmgr32.h)
[Ab Windows 8 und Windows Server 2012 wurde diese Funktion veraltet. Verwenden Sie stattdessen CM_Free_Log_Conf .]
Die funktion CM_Free_Log_Conf_Ex entfernt eine logische Konfiguration und alle zugeordneten Ressourcendeskriptoren aus einem lokalen oder einem Remotecomputer.
Syntax
CMAPI CONFIGRET CM_Free_Log_Conf_Ex(
[in] LOG_CONF lcLogConfToBeFreed,
[in] ULONG ulFlags,
[in, optional] HMACHINE hMachine
);
Parameter
[in] lcLogConfToBeFreed
Anrufer-bereitgestellter Handle für eine logische Konfiguration. Dieser Handle muss zuvor abgerufen worden sein, indem eine der folgenden Funktionen aufgerufen wird:
[in] ulFlags
Nicht verwendet, muss null sein.
[in, optional] hMachine
Vom Anrufer bereitgestellter Maschinenziehpunkt, der von einem vorherigen Aufruf zu CM_Connect_Machine abgerufen wurde.
Rückgabewert
Wenn der Vorgang erfolgreich ist, gibt die Funktion CR_SUCCESS zurück. Andernfalls wird eine der in Cfgmgr32.h definierten CR_-präfixierten Fehlercodes zurückgegeben.
Hinweise
Das Aufrufen CM_Free_Log_Conf_Ex kann dazu führen, dass die von CM_Get_First_Log_Conf_Ex zurückgegebenen Ziehpunkte und CM_Get_Next_Log_Conf_Ex ungültig werden. Wenn Sie nach dem Aufrufen CM_Free_Log_Conf_Ex logische Konfigurationen abrufen möchten, muss der Code CM_Get_First_Log_Conf_Ex erneut aufrufen und bei der ersten Konfiguration beginnen.
Beachten Sie, dass das Aufrufen von CM_Free_Log_Conf_Ex die Konfiguration freigibt, aber nicht das Handle der Konfiguration. Rufen Sie zum Freigeben des Handles CM_Free_Log_Conf_Handle_Ex an.
Aufrufer dieser Funktion müssen über SeLoadDriverPrivilege verfügen. (Berechtigungen werden in der Microsoft Windows SDK Dokumentation beschrieben.)
Die Funktionalität für den Zugriff auf Remotecomputer wurde in Windows 8 und Windows Server 2012 und späteren Betriebssystemen entfernt, damit Sie nicht auf Remotecomputer zugreifen können, wenn sie auf diesen Versionen von Windows ausgeführt werden.
Anforderungen
Unterstützte Mindestversion (Client) | Verfügbar in Microsoft Windows 2000 und höheren Versionen von Windows. |
Zielplattform | Desktop |
Header | cfgmgr32.h (include Cfgmgr32.h) |
Bibliothek | Cfgmgr32.lib |
DLL | Cfgmgr32.dll |